When assembling the new pin in the end of the prop shaft a very large press
is required and the dimensional control is absolutely critical. I believe
within .006. I would have to check the specs but you will have to do it. Not
every shop can press the shaft in. I haven't had to do one in years but I do
recall the high load to press the pin out and in.
